Boullier in angry exchange with 'Freddo' journalist

Eric Boullier has struck back at suggestions he is not fit to continue in his role at McLaren due to the reported staff revolt, and during his preparations for the French Grand Prix he got involved in a heated exchange to the journalist who broke the story involving the use of Freddo bars as bonuses. An anonymous staff member at McLaren recently spoke to Jonathan McEvoy of the Daily Mail about the "toxic" atmosphere behind the scenes within the team, and suggested that the senior management, including Boullier, commanded no respect.
